A student argues that 0.01% = 0.01 because in 0.01%, the percent is already written as a decimal. How do you respond?

Bogus.

1% = 0.01

because "percent" means "per 100"

1 per 100 = 1/100 = 1%

.01% means .01/100 = .0001
